I've ran my T/A many many times @ Monroe, 7.491 is my best time. I must warn you that it is not even a 1/8 th. it's like 50 ft. short and the corner at the end sucks, I've warped my rotors on that track.
It would be nice to see a fast 4th. generation f-bod out there. The old school racers tell me that our cars could never run against their cars because of emmissions constraints, I told them BULLSHIT, you are dead wrong.
I would LOVE to see Sardog go to Monroe and hand some of those guys their asses. Traction is an issue as well as an M6 car could be a bitch to launch @ Monroe.
Sundays are the best, friday nights the track gets to cold and wet and makes it very hard to hook.
It sucks because I'm not sure what my T/A would do in the 1/4 mi. I have raced several cars that run 12.8s / 12.9s @ PR and i can put a good car length on them on the short track @ Monroe, so I figure I must at least be in the 12s, Shaun agrees with this statement.

What are they like with tech? Not sure what you mean Sardog.
There's no water box, can't run open headers. Battery needs to be secure, overflow for coolant, take out floor mats, put on a helmit and race.
It's kind of a low key backyard in the dirt fun, small town stuff. Anything can happen though. I've beat Cobras, Supras,Grand National, Hemi Challenger........I was able took hook up and they couldn't, so I won.
I like bracket racing and trying to win trophys. I'm sure April 1st. will be T&T That's OK there is still a lot of grudge racing going on. I'm in a on going battle against by buddies 69 Mach 1 w/351 H/C, I want to hand him his A$$ this year
I didn't plan on going out on 4/1, however, if you go Sardog I will be there to see your car run, I will run too!
Oh, and one last thing. For the M6 cars, you have to keep your foot on the brake so you don't roll, the surface is not quite level. I guess some guys put sandbags on the left side for traction, he he you didn't hear that from me.

#31
The gates open @ 6:00 and we can start running our cars as soon as the sportsman tree is set up. Go on the 3rd. yellow light. One night I ran my T/A 12 times, there was only 25 cars there that night, hopefully we'll have 50 or 60 cars. They do have some cars that run in the 5s. Shaun has a friend that runs a 68 camaro w/small block and it's one of the fastest cars out there, it's purple, the guys name is Bill.
As far as racing for $$, I think most of us who run @ Monroe are broke
If you grew up in a small town you may enjoy yourself. I grew up in Seattle but I like the small town atmosphere, country folk, clean the **** off your boots and go racin. Hope the weather holds.
Oh, and I almost forgot...no water at all, it would just roll down the banked track to the dirt and then we woulld have MUD. You do your burnout on the banked corner before you stage @ the llight. I wish we could use water though, because my rearend is going out and I hope I don't break it. Shaun told me to run it till it breaks.
